A teacher from Comrat State University presented the results of research in the field of supporting business infrastructure of the municipality at an international scientific and practical conference

On October 10, 2024, the opening of the 18th edition of the International Scientific-Practical Conference "Economic Growth in the Face of Global Challenges: Strengthening National Economies and Reducing Social Inequalities" took place. This year the conference of the National Institute of Economic Research (INCE) within the Academy of Economic Studies from Moldova is organized in partnership with the Institute for World Economy of the Romanian Academy and the Research Institute for Agricultural Economy and Rural Development from Romania.

In the opening of the conference, the director of INCE, Olga Gagauz, doctor habilitate, research associate, emphasized that the main objective of the conference is to promote scientific excellence, facilitate the dissemination of research results and strengthen international partnerships. Another important goal is to increase access to European funding, especially through the Horizon Europe program for research and innovation.

The rector of ASEM, professor and corresponding member of ASEM, welcomed the participants, emphasizing the importance of the conference as an academic platform that addresses the most current topics in the economic and social field.

After the plenary session, the conference proceedings were held in five sections, each addressing key areas of contemporary research and development. Sections cover a wide range of topics, including business competitiveness and digital transformation, sustainable agri-food systems and rural development, sustainable finance and the circular economy, well-being and social inclusion, and innovative approaches to managing demographic processes. rural development, sustainable finance and the circular economy, well-being and social inclusion and innovative approaches to managing demographic processes.

Assoc. Prof., Dr., LEVITSKAIA presented report "FEATURES OF THE ENTREPRENEURSHIP SUPPORT INFRASTRUCTURE DEVELOPMENT AT THE MUNICIPAL LEVEL" as a result or the study of business support infrastructure models in a territorial context based on the "Feasibility Study of the Regional Business Center of the Municipality of Comrat" was developed with the support of the project "Strong Enterprises and Communities for Moldova" (GIZ).

This year, over 150 participants registered for the conference, including approximately 40 participants from Romania, representing various universities and research institutions; 22 participants from Ukraine; 15 from Italy; 8 from Turkey, as well as researchers from Azerbaijan, the Netherlands, the USA, Norway, Poland and Bulgaria.
